The issue of perceived rigging usually arises when gamers fail to win regardless of common participation. Due to cognitive biases and the psychological side of playing, people might mistakenly consider that the system is rigged in the event that they discover patterns of losses. This phenomenon is called the "illusion of control," the place players really feel an emotional connection to their loss, projecting their frustrations onto the lottery's integrity.

Despite the joy of profitable, many lottery winners encounter a series of pitfalls post-victory. One of probably the most cited issues is the phenomenon often known as "sudden wealth syndrome." The abrupt change in financial status can lead to stress, anxiousness, and even depression. Many winners find themselves bombarded with requests for cash from associates, household, and charitable organizations, leaving them feeling overwhelmed. Additionally, poor financial choices, such as ill-advised investments or extreme spending, can additional erode wealth. Awareness of these pitfalls is the primary step in path of circumventing them, allowing winners to take pleasure in their winnings whereas sustaining their financial targets.

Lotto gamers usually exhibit a phenomenon known as the "gambler's fallacy," believing that previous occasions can affect future outcomes in a random setting. For example, if a selected number hasn’t been drawn in a while, some gamers would possibly really feel it’s "due" to be chosen quickly. This fallacy can contribute to feelings of distrust when their selected numbers don't win, whatever the underlying randomness.
